Story By: LINDA’S SPEEDWAY – JONESTOWN, PA – Linda’s Speedway is coming off the annual practice night held on March 29, 2024 and it was an overwhelming success. With a bustling pit area hosting 120 cars, the event showcased a thrilling preview of the racing talent set to compete in the upcoming season.
The practice night offered three comprehensive sessions for all the classes that graced the track, which included a mixture of 270 Micro Sprints, All Star Slingshots, Junior Slingshots, Jr Sprints, and Chargers that will be seen on opening night this coming Friday. Participants and fans alike are now building with excitement as everyone looks forward to this Friday April 5th.
The Speedway gates will open at 5:00 pm, with practice laps beginning at 7:00 pm. Racing action will kick off immediately following the practice sessions. Fans eager to catch every moment of the action will be pleased to know that the grandstand admission prices have been maintained, showcasing Linda’s Speedway’s commitment to being a family-affordable race track. Adult tickets are priced at $5 each, while children aged 6-12 can enjoy the event for just $3.
For the racers, a pit pass is available at $30, with car registration tagged at $20. Additionally, the Speedway offers transponder rentals at $20 to assist in monitoring lap times and race positions for those do that not have their own.
